Peter Dinklage and Josh Brolin will be the comedy duo you never thought you needed. According to the Hollywood Reporterthe two actors will be playing, as the title suggests, brothers in the upcoming project. 

Tropic Thunder and Get Hard writer Etan Cohen will develop the script, with American Sniper producer Andrew Lazar attached to the film as well. Both of the protagonists are set to produce the film as well, via their respective production companies Brolin Productions and Dinklage's Estuary Films. Legendary Entertainment, which has been attached to acclaimed films such as blacKkKlansman, reportedly signed on to the project after a bidding war.

Plot details surrounding the upcoming film are scant, however with two actors such as Brolin, who plays the notorious antagonist Thanos in the Marvel Cinematic Universe, and Dinklage who's widely acclaimed for his role as Tyrian in Game of Thrones, it shouldn't be too difficult to create excitement. Although both actors are known for their dramatic portrayal, they have had their stints in comedy, with Brolin's Deadpool appearance and Tyrian's epic Saturday Night Live gig. 

Both Linklage and Brolin have highly anticipated projects gearing up for release. Brolin will reprise his role as Thanos in the upcoming Avengers: Endgame, and Linklage is set to return Tyrian to the small-screen when GoT returns for its final season in AprilGiven the hecticness of the next few months, production for Brothers will likely begin thereafter.
